The Top Reasons To Warm-up Before Your Exercise Routine To Prevent Injuries

HealthThe Top Reasons To Warm-up Before Your Exercise Routine To Prevent Injuries

If you have decided to take up a new exercise routine then you are to be commended for that because many people can neither find the opportunity or the motivation to do so. The hardest part is starting and once you start doing exercise on a regular basis then it becomes second nature to you and you feel bad when you miss out on an opportunity to burn some calories and to get fitter. The thing that you have to remember however is that slowly wins the race because if you start off too strong then there is a higher likelihood that you will end up injuring yourself and this will put back your new lifestyle many weeks. At that point, you might find it difficult to motivate yourself to begin again and that would be a great shame.

This is why it is so important to make sure that you do the necessary warm-up exercises every single time and there is also an essential piece of kit that everyone should be using in order to prevent injury. The following are just some of the top reasons why we all need to do a warm-up before any exercise routine.

  1. It increases body temperature – The right body temperature is essential if your muscles are to be warm enough in order to be able to perform at their optimum. If you don’t know already, you should be aware that as your muscles get warmer, more oxygen is supplied to your muscles and that means that you can perform more and perform more easily. It also gives your heart the perfect opportunity to get yourself ready for the exercise that lies ahead.
  2. It will reduce risk of injury – Always make sure that you’re wearing your Kinesio tape when both warming up and working out when doing any sport. By doing the correct kind of warm-up, it greatly reduces your chances of hurting yourself and it will allow you to reach your fitness goals. A good warm-up will help your muscles to stretch and be ready for the HIIT routine that you’re going to put them through soon.
  3. Mental preparation & flexibility – As well as getting your body ready for your exercise routine, it also helps to prepare you mentally for what lies ahead. It provides you with the perfect motivation that you need to get yourself out of that armchair, to get on your running shoes and to get out there and really do something that is going to improve upon your overall fitness and your overall health both physically and mentally.
